Experimental Study On Seismoelectric Effect Of Carbonate Rocks In Karst Area

Under the action of elastic energy in porous media containing fluid,the seismoelectric effect is produced by the coupling of mechanical energy and electrical energy.The seismoelectric conversion mainly produced at the solid-liquid interface is closely related to the physical parameters of porous media,and the correlation between them is expected to lead to new geophysical prospecting methods in oil logging and geological prediction.Many scholars have done a lot of research work in seismoelectric logging.Based on previous studies,this paper has carried out a series of seismoelectric experiments on carbonate rocks in karst areas.Firstly,the feasibility of indoor detection of carbonate seismoelectric effect is analyzed theoretically,and a set of seismoelectric measurement system for rock samples for laboratory observation is constructed.Through the seismoelectric comparison experiment of plexiglass and sandstone samples,it is verified that the system can record the converted electrical signals of solid-liquid two-phase seismoelectric interface with high stability and reliability.On-site sampling of carbonate rocks in typical karst areas,processing and preparing rock samples with uniform specifications,and using the seismoelectric measurement system to observe seismoelectric data.The results show that:(1)The seismoelectric signals of moderately weathered limestone and dolomitic limestone are not obvious,and obvious seismoelectric conversion signals are detected at the interface of argillaceous dolomite.(2)By adjusting the source excitation voltage and the distance between the source and the rock sample interface,it is found that the seismoelectric signal is positively correlated with the elastic energy propagating to the interface.(3)By changing the receiving position of the electrode,the seismoelectric signal decreases exponentially as the electrode moves away from the rock sample interface,but the take-off time of the seismoelectric signal tends to be consistent,thus confirming that the transition of the carbonate rock seismoelectric interface under elastic energy disturbance is synchronized to each electrode in the form of electromagnetic radiation,which is also the key to realize the field seismoelectric exploration.(4)Comparing the characteristics of seismoelectric signals of limestone,dolomite and sandstone horizontally,it is found that the difference in porosity of rock samples is the biggest reason for the difference in seismoelectric interface conversion among the three rock samples,which indicates that the seismoelectric effect is sensitive to the pore parameters of rocks,and proves that the seismoelectric characteristics of rocks are expected to represent the physical parameters of rock reservoirs.Based on the indoor measurement results of carbonate seismoelectric experiments,this paper studies the influencing factors of carbonate seismoelectric characteristics from multiple dimensions,and verifies the feasibility of applying seismoelectric exploration to karst exploration in karst areas.On this basis,some beneficial attempts are made for real karst seismoelectric exploration in karst areas.
